There's been a lot of discussions in the past about this type of module. Do a search on this forum and you'll find lots of info.

In the end, the general consensus is that these devices will not work because a car would literally need to be buried in the ground or underwater for the circuit to complete and for the device to be effective.

after closer inspection and driving with this device for 42000km I noticed little things like bolts, that are not attached to vehicles frame directly - would rust. Other then that, my car was like new, without a single spot or rust. Its like it came off the lot just now. Also I did spray my car before winter.
Does it work? Not really, but I got it because dealership gives 10 years rust free warranty and ups a value to your car if you decide to sell it.
